My client, an extremely busy countryside pub located in the heart of the South Downs near Goodwood, is currently looking for an experienced Head Chef to join their friendly and professional kitchen team.

The team at the pub pride themselves on delivering high-quality seasonal British food using fresh produce sourced from trusted local suppliers. This role is ideally suited to a seasoned chef.

How to prepare for a job interview at Baxendale Mason

Know Your Ingredients

Familiarise yourself with seasonal British produce and local suppliers. Be ready to discuss how you would incorporate fresh ingredients into the menu, showcasing your passion for quality food.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As a Head Chef, you'll be leading a team.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ed kitchen staff in the past, resolved conflicts, or improved team efficiency. This will demonstrate your ability to lead effectively.

Demonstrate Your Creativity

Think about unique dishes or twists on traditional recipes that you could bring to the pub. Presenting innovative ideas during the interview can set you apart and show your culinary flair.

Understand the Pub's Culture

Research the pub's ethos and menu style. Being able to articulate how your values align with theirs will show that you're not just looking for any job, but that you're genuinely interested in contributing to their team.
